Governor Sonko Names ‘Super CEC’ to Coordinate Nairobi County Affairs

July 23, 2019

Nairobi Governor Mike Sonko has found his ‘own Matiang’i’.

In a move similar to the one instituted by President Uhuru when he ‘promoted’  Interior CS Fred Matiang’i to ‘super’ CS, Sonko has appointed Charles Kerich as ‘Super CEC’.

Kerich, who was appointed as the CEC for Finance only two months ago, will supervise the 10 sectors of the Nairobi county government by implementing and coordinating programmes.

Sonko, in an executive order on Monday, said it was necessary for him to appoint someone for proper discharge of the executive authority across the county.

Kerich’s new role includes receiving reports from all CECs and providing supervisory leadership throughout the delivery cycle of all county government projects.

The former journalist is also required to monitor and evaluate the follow up mechanisms for resources allocated to all sectors and priority programme and projects to ensure proper utilization of the targeted outcomes.

“He will oversee the implementation and communication of all county government projects and any other function ancillary to the above as may be directed by the governor,” stated the order.

Additionally, Kerich will also present accurate and timely progress to Sonko and any other function ancillary to the above as may be directed by the governor.

Kerich has served as CEC in four departments; ICT, Lands, Health and Finance.
